just some of the problems drivers in san jose are dealing with. today, a city council committee will look at ways do fix the problems. amy hollyfield joins us or we will have matt chemical are -- keller will join us. >> good morning kristen, the roads are revealed to be deteriorating over the past 10 years. if something is not done, it is only going do get worse. the city auditor released a report and found 60 percent of the roads show significant distress and are worn to where expensive repairs are needed. an opinion survey gives street repair the lowest rating of any service service and they need $504 million just to eliminate the backlog of poor roads in san jose. another $104 million each year the next decade to raise from "fair," to "good," which is $80 million more than the current
6:45 am
funding. >> keeping your house in order is important. the way your house is, is how people are treated. i would put it as a high priority. >> the report reveals san jose relies on state gas taxes, federal grants and one time sources of funding and other cities do, but many rely on money from the john fund and sales tax revenue. the city auditor wants the leaders to find a sustainable and predictable funding strain to maintain the roads and that is what the city council will do at the meeting starting at 1:30 this afternoon. san francisco-based twitter is working with law enforcement to see if death threats are real against a cofounder including a picture of jack dorsey in the crosshair of a rifle telescope with a message condemning twit we for shutting down isis-related accounts along with the words "we always come back,"
